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
560 1299082872 74259308488
576 88127532
576 88127532
22760 286 639
All about undefined
Interested in learning more?
576 88127532
22760 286 639
See more
2414995368 219178181
6001766 25207404063 7080628961 47 60047
See more
51 33280
89 4457276 683516
See more